| | * Use backing store formats with alphaAllan Sandfeld Jensen2016-01-083-51/+38
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| We depend on being able to punch holes in the backing store when integrating with FBO elements. To do that we need a format with an alpha channel. This was only working previously because RGB32 didn't mask when filling or when converting to ARGB32_PM, but other formats didn't. Also unifies the logic for getting alpha versions of QImage formats. | * xcb: Use a placeholder QScreen when there are no outputs connectedBłażej Szczygieł2015-12-111-2/+2
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| If no screens are available, windows could disappear, could stop rendering graphics, or the application could crash. This is a real use case in several scenarios: with x11vnc, when all monitors are physically disconnected from a desktop machine, or in some cases even when the monitor sleeps. Now when the last screen is disconnected, it is transformed into a fake screen. When a physical screen appears, the fake QScreen is transformed into a representation of the physical screen. Every virtual desktop has its own fake screen, and primary screens must belong to the primary virtual desktop. It fixes updating screen geometry on temporarily disabled screens in the middle of the mode switch. Expected results: Windows don't disappear, the application doesn't crash, and QMenu is displayed on the appropriate screen.
